The Rise of the Active Grandmother
The traditional image of a grandmother – a nurturing, home-bound figure – is rapidly evolving. While those qualities remain cherished, today’s grandmothers are increasingly independent, adventurous, and digitally connected. This transformation isn’t merely a matter of personal preference, but also a reflection of broader societal changes. Increased life expectancy, advancements in healthcare, and greater financial security for many women have all contributed to this shift. Grandmothers are living longer, healthier lives and have more opportunities to pursue their interests and passions. Furthermore, the changing dynamics of family structures mean that grandmothers often have more freedom and flexibility to dedicate time to themselves and their own pursuits.
This isn’t solely a Western phenomenon; it’s a global trend, although the specific manifestations may vary across cultures. In some societies, grandmothers are taking on leadership roles in their communities, while in others, they are pioneering new businesses or volunteering their time to charitable causes. The common thread is a desire to remain active, engaged, and relevant, defying stereotypes and setting a positive example for future generations. The accessibility of information, through the internet and social media, also plays a role, allowing grandmothers to connect with like-minded individuals and share their experiences.
Technological Adoption and Connection
One of the key catalysts of the active grandmother phenomenon is the widespread adoption of technology. Grandmothers are no longer intimidated by smartphones, tablets, or social media; instead, they are embracing these tools to stay connected with family and friends, learn new skills, and explore new interests. Many are using video conferencing to maintain close relationships with grandchildren who live far away, while others are joining online communities dedicated to their hobbies or passions. This digital literacy empowers them to remain engaged in the world around them and to continue learning and growing.
Social media platforms, in particular, have provided a powerful platform for grandmothers to share their stories and connect with others. Groups dedicated to travel, crafting, gardening, or simply living a fulfilling life offer a sense of community and support. This sense of belonging is crucial, especially for those who may have recently retired or experienced other significant life changes. The ability to share experiences, gain advice, and receive encouragement from others can boost confidence and motivation.

Building a Successful Small Business
Starting a small business can be a daunting task, but it’s also incredibly rewarding. Grandmothers who are considering entrepreneurship should start by carefully assessing their skills, interests, and resources. They should also conduct market research to identify a viable business opportunity. Creating a business plan is essential, outlining their goals, strategies, and financial projections. Networking with other entrepreneurs and seeking advice from mentors can provide valuable support and guidance. Marketing and promotion are crucial for attracting customers, and utilizing social media and online advertising can be highly effective.
Access to funding can be a challenge for new entrepreneurs, but there are various options available, including small business loans, grants, and crowdfunding. It’s important to thoroughly research these options and to choose the one that best suits their needs. Finally, it’s crucial to maintain a positive attitude, be persistent, and be willing to learn from mistakes. Entrepreneurship is a journey, and setbacks are inevitable, but with dedication and perseverance, success is achievable.
